if i have taken maths basic in 10th so will there be any problems if i want to go for commerce in 10+2 and further studies like ca or mba?? will i be elegible??

Dear Alok, courses like CA and MBA accept any educational qualification. You are eligible to study MBA or CA even if you have studied Mathematics only until the 10th but want to take up commerce in 10+2. For CA, you should have completed 10+2 in any stream and for studying MBA, you need to have a Bachelor's degree in any discipline. So it is perfectly ok.
